An out-of-control SUV jumped the curb and plowed onto a sidewalk near the Lincoln Tunnel in midtown Manhattan Thursday, hitting and seriously injuring two pedestrians, and sending eight others to the hospital, officials say. Police say two people on the sidewalk were hit by the car that barreled onto the 400 block of West 37th Street by Ninth Avenue, near the Lincoln Tunnel, around 12:30 p.m. Eight people were inside the SUV, which had Georgia license plates, and were also taken to the hospital, though they had just minor injuries. A store owner across the street, Jonny Giordani, says he saw the black SUV hit a car and lose control, hitting two more cars before vaulting onto the sidewalk, hitting the two pedestrians.  The witness said they seemed OK and alert while being attended to by EMS, but they were bleeding. Fire officials say they’re in stable condition at a local hospital.  Neighbors say they heard screeching, then a shocking series of booms in the crash. “Just the sound of it, I was shocked — even my baby heard it and she was crying,” said Ani Solano, who heard the the crash from behind the closed windows of her fourth-floor apartment.  The SUV broke a tree and the metal guard around it when it hurtled onto the sidewalk. It became wedged between the tree and the windows of a luxury apartment building called Hudson Crossing, News 4 video from the scene shows.  The woman driving the SUV hasn’t been issued any summons or charge, according to police. Preliminary investigation indicates it was an acicdent in which the SUV and a black car bumped, and that’s what sent the SUV careening out of control and onto the sidewalk.
